    This was the first time we took a trip with our pups. Was skeptical at first but found the frances street bottle inn online and decided to make a reservation. We felt right at home the minute we set foot on the property since Mark was so warm and welcoming. Even my dog that is skittish with people, took to him instantly.(my dog loved him so much she run towards bottle inn and into his office.) Room 8 was spacious and with a nice king size bed. The place is an older building so has some character to it. Has a private courtyard which was good for us and the doggies. Breakfast is simple and good. Coffee and pastries and they don't mind if you eat breakfast with your pups either! You can also rent bikes which we did one day and we rode all around key west and also took the dogs to the dog beach. All in all we had a great time and my dogs also loved the place. I recommend this spot to anyone with doggies or even if you don't.

This impressive Queen Anne Victorian style house was designed as a one-bedroom mansion. What it lacked in bedrooms it more than made up for with its open water views, elegant public rooms, two story balconies, and large stained glass windows to catch the ocean breezes. little bit of History piece: William Curry came to Key West, from the Bahamas, penniless. He became a wrecker and with his massive fortune, built eight mansions in Key West and became Florida's first millionaire. His daughters wed wealthy men as well. One of his daughters, Florida Euphemia, married Judge Vining Harris. Interesting Fact: Electricity was a novelty and a luxury in the 1890's. Mrs. Harris wanted the best and was able to engage Thomas Edison to oversee the electrical design and installation for the house.
